Android ViewStub 动态加载大揭秘
Android 的 ViewStub 一直是开发者们关注的焦点之一,其中一个关键问题就是它能否动态加载,就让我们深入探讨这个话题,为您揭开 ViewStub 动态加载的神秘面纱。
ViewStub 是 Android 布局优化中的一个重要组件,它的主要作用是在需要时才加载视图,从而提高应用的性能和响应速度,关于它是否能够动态加载,很多开发者存在疑惑。

Android ViewStub 是可以实现动态加载的,这一特性为开发者提供了更多的灵活性和优化空间,在实现动态加载时,需要注意一些关键的步骤和要点。
要确保正确设置 ViewStub 的属性,设置合适的 layout 资源,以便在加载时能够正确展示所需的视图。

通过代码触发加载操作,这需要调用特定的方法来实现 ViewStub 的展开和视图的加载。
还需要处理好加载过程中的各种异常情况,保证应用的稳定性和流畅性。
在实际开发中,合理运用 ViewStub 的动态加载功能,可以有效减少初始布局的复杂性,提升用户体验,在某些特定场景下,如网络请求获取数据后再决定是否加载特定视图,ViewStub 就能发挥出其独特的优势。
掌握 Android ViewStub 的动态加载技巧对于优化应用性能和用户体验具有重要意义,希望通过本文的介绍,能让您对这一功能有更深入的理解和运用。
参考来源:Android 开发官方文档及相关技术论坛
仅供参考,您可以根据实际需求进行调整和修改。